Reading the gear grumble gear brought back fin memories for me. I also have problems getting them off someimes and I will try some of the tricks. Springs have always been appealing as well.

My bigger problem is getting my dive boots off. I have ankle length zippered heavy sole neoprene boots and they just LOVE to stay on my feet. I try and roll them. kick them off by the heel, wiggle them - whatever. The suction is just too great. Combined with my less than perfect flexibility this can be a real problem.

Any tricks to getting them off?

Thanks
 
Can you add water to the top of the boot. If you can fill the boot the suction will be eliminated. If it is because your ankles are to big it just takes work, unless you want to grease the inside.

Thin neoprene socks. They make getting in and out of heavy wetsuits a breeze as well.
